What Are AI Tokens?
AI tokens combine artificial intelligence with blockchain technology. AI tokens have specific purposes within AI projects, like paying for computational power, accessing AI models, or governing decentralized AI networks. Some tokens fund AI development teams. Other tokens are used as payment for AI services like trading bots, data processing or machine learning operations.
Some tokens simply fund companies building AI products. Others integrate more deeply, using blockchain to decentralize AI training, share datasets, or distribute computing resources across networks.
Why You Need to Do Your Own Research
The AI sector attracts major attention. The AI sector also attracts projects that overpromise and underdeliver. New AI tokens launch regularly. Not all of them have solid foundations. Some projects use AI buzzwords without meaningful technology behind them. Others may have legitimate goals but lack the team or resources to achieve them.
When you do your own research, verify claims, check team credentials, understand tokenomics, and assess whether the project solves a real problem. Using Trust Wallet's Token Information and Price Charts
When you find an AI token that interests you, start by reviewing its information using Trust Wallet. Open the token's page to view the contract address, which helps you verify you're looking at the legitimate token rather than a copycat. Cross-reference the address with the project's official website and social media channels.
Trust Wallet shows you the token's market cap and circulating supply, giving you a sense of the project's size and how tokens are distributed. The token information section includes links to the project's website and social channels. Use these to verify the team's identity, read the whitepaper, and assess community engagement. Active, transparent teams generally present lower risk than anonymous teams with minimal public presence.
Trust Wallet's built-in price charts let you track token performance over different timeframes. Look at volume alongside price. High trading volume during price increases suggests genuine interest, while price spikes on low volume might indicate manipulation. Compare the AI token's chart to major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um. If the token's price movements closely mirror these larger assets, it might simply be riding overall market sentiment rather than responding to its own developments. Check how the token performed during recent market downturns, too. Tokens that hold value relatively well during bear markets often have stronger communities and use cases.
Setting Up Price Alerts
Trust Wallet's alert feature lets you monitor AI tokens without constantly checking prices. When you add a token to your watchlist, you'll receive notifications if the price moves up or down by more than 10%. The 10% threshold filters out normal market noise while catching meaningful price changes that deserve your attention.
Red Flags to Watch For
Extremely rapid price increases often mean unsustainable hype rather than solid growth. Check whether price movements match actual project developments or just follow social media buzz.
Anonymous or unverified teams should raise concerns, especially in AI projects where technical expertise matters. Legitimate AI projects typically showcase their teams' backgrounds in artificial intelligence, blockchain development, or both. Be skeptical of projects promising unrealistic returns or hiding behind overly technical language that makes simple concepts sound complicated.
Watch for tokens with very few holders or where a handful of wallets control most of the supply. Concentrated ownership creates the risk of price manipulation. Trust Wallet's token information can help you spot these patterns. You may need to check blockchain explorers for detailed holder data.
Step-by-Step Guide to Adding Custom Tokens
Adding a custom token to Trust Wallet is a simple process. Follow these steps to ensure that your new token is properly integrated into your wallet:
Launch the Trust Wallet app on your mobile device.
On the main screen, click the asset layout button.
Click the “manage crypto” button option to start the process of adding a new token.
Next, click the “+” button option to start the process of adding a new token.
Choose the correct blockchain network from the dropdown menu (e.g. Ethereum, Binance Smart Chain). Make sure you select the network that matches the token’s blockchain.
Input the token’s contract address. You can find this information on the token’s official website or block explorer.
Enter the full name of the token.
Enter the token’s symbol (e.g. ETH for Ethereum).
Input the number of decimals the token uses. This is typically found along with the contract address.
Review the details you’ve entered to ensure they are correct.
Tap “Import” to complete the process.
